
AFTERCARE
Proper aftercare is just as important as the tattoo itself. Following these guidelines will help your tattoo heal smoothly, keep the details crisp, and ensure the best long-term results.
DAY-OF CARE
-
After 3 hours, remove the bandage gently and wash with warm water and mild unscented soap. DO NOT REBANDAGE.
-
Apply a thin layer unscented lotion 3 times a day.
-
Stay out of sunlight and tanning booths until tattoo is healed, at least 2 weeks.
-
Do not soak tattoo in tub, sauna, jacuzzi or go swimming while your new tattoo is healing. Showers are fine.
-
DO NOT RUB or PICK the treated area while it is healing.
-
Extreme sun and exposure over the years can and will fade your tattoo. This can be minimized by using SPF!
-
Your tattoo should heal in 3-4 weeks.


CLEANING & DRYING
-
Always wash your hands before cleaning the tattoo.
-
In the shower, use warm water and antibacterial soap to remove all of the excess on the surface of the tattoo.
-
Make sure the plasma and sweat is fully washed off of the tattoo during this process.
GENERAL CARE
-
Make sure your hands are always clean before cleaning your tattoo.
-
Your tattoo needs to be cleaned twice a day with antibacterial soap.
-
Never use oil based products or alcohol based products on fresh wound tattoos.
-
After the tattoo is cleaned, apply a THIN layer of aftercare balm or unscented lotion.
-
Never go swimming while your tattoo is healing especially fresh.
-
Tattoos take 10-21 days to fully heal. It will be sore, swollen, and sometimes red for the first couple days to a week.
When the tattoo starts flaking/scabbing do NOT touch or peel the tattoo because it will ruin the process the healing.
